About the Role
An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ced Operations Co-ordinator to join a growing and dynamic logistics business following a recent period of expansion.
This role sits within a busy operations and bookings team and will focus on managing import and export shipments across sea and road, ensuring the smooth movement of goods in line with current legislation and best practice.
It is a busy, hands-on position ideal for someone who thrives in a cooperative environment and enjoys problem-solving and prioritising workloads.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age import and export shipments from booking through to final delivery
- Coordinate transport across sea freight and road freight operations
- Liaise with customers, hauliers, shipping lines and international partners
- Handle shipping documentation and support customs-related processes
- Provide proactive updates to customers on shipment progress
- Resolve operational issues efficiently and prioritise urgent requirements
- Support account management and maintain strong client relationships
